Sarnia, ON, CA

The Canadian city of Sarnia is directly across the St. Clair River from Port Huron. U.S. pleasure boats heading up Lake Huron for Georgian Bay or the North Channel often make Sarnia their point of entry into Canada. Clearing through here makes cruising up the Canadian side of the lake much easier.

The popular summer resort of Port Huron sits at the entrance to the St. Clair River at the south end of Lake Huron. Be sure to visit the Port Huron Museum, where tours are available for Carnegie Center, Huron Lightship Museum, Thomas Edison Depot Museum and the Fort Gratiot Lighthouse.
Port Huron is a good place to provision or study charts in preparation for an extended cruise. The full-service facilities here welcome transients and cater to just about any size vessel.
